Budget Deficit Will Reach 5.5% of GDP In 2009

May 2009 | Economic Analysis

While the latest data from the Romanian Ministry of Finance indicates that the government is on track to meet its budget deficit target of 4.6% of GDP (5.1% of GDP under EU accounting standards) this year, we caution that the risks that the government will exceed this limit is elevated. We are particularly concerned by the cyclical nature of government spending, and the likely uptick in spending ahead of the presidential election which is scheduled for the latter months of the year. As such, we forecast a budget deficit of 5.5% of GDP in 2009.
